KURS

QA Automatizacija

Za početnike
Cilj kursa QA Automatizacija je sticanje veština planiranja, razvoja i održavanja automatizovanih QA skripti.
Obuka će obuhvatati sve vrste automatizovanog testiranja, odnosno testiranje Unit, Integration i System/End-to-end. Takođe, dotaći ćemo se tema nefunkcionalnog testiranja kao što su testiranje performansi i sigurnosno testiranje. Obrađivaće se prakse isporuke softvera, korišćenje sistema za integraciju softvera i izvođenje testa za svaku promenu aplikacije.
Na kraju kursa svako od vas će imati potrebne veštine za izgradnju i integraciju pojedinačnih rešenja za automatizaciju web aplikacija, koristeći C# programski jezik.
* omogućeno plaćanje na 2 rate

Veštine koje ćete steći:

Uz ovaj kurs preporučujemo

SoftUni QA osnove

QA osnove - novembar 2023

Uvod u C# - januar 2024

Teme:

Uvod u kurs
  • Kurikulum
  • Predavači
  • Ispit
  • Materijali za učenje
Pregled automatizacije testiranja
  • Testiranje, vrste testova i nivoi testova
  • Automatizacija testiranja, okviri i alati
  • Kontinuirana integracija i kontinuirana isporuka
Unit Testing i NUnit
  • Unit testiranje koncepti
  • Frameworks
  • NUnit
API-Testing-and-REST
  • Web servisi
  • RESTful APIs
  • Integracija i API testiranje
  • Postman
  • NUnit + RestSharp
Selenium - Osnove
  • Postavka Seleniuma
  • Pisanje testova za Selenium
  • Interakcija sa Page Elements
  • Selektori i XPath
Selenium-Advanced-and-POM
  • Selenium Waits
  • Page Object Model (POM)
  • Selenium alternative
Appium Desktop Testiranje
  • Appium Uvod
  • Appium za Windows App Automation
Appium mobilno testiranje
  • Android Emulator
  • Appium za Android App
Postavljanje testnog okruženja
  • Pregled testnog okruženja
  • Upravljanje podacima testiranja
  • Strategija podataka za sintetičke i proizvodne testove
Testiranje performansi
  • Šta je Performance Testing?
  • Zašto Performance Testing?
  • Vrste Performance Testing-a
Uvod u Security Testing
  • Šta je Security Testing?
  • Zašto Security Testing?
  • Vrste Security Testing-a
Kontinuirana integracija
  • Uvod u kontinuiranu integraciju i kontinuiranu isporuku
  • GitHub akcije
Priprema za ispit
  • Priprema za ispit će se održati: uskoro.
Redovni ispit
  • Praktični ispit će se održati: uskoro.
  • Teorijski ispit će se održati: uskoro.
Ponovo polaganje ispita
  • Praktični ispit će se održati: uskoro.
  • Teorijski ispit će se održati: uskoro.

Kome je kurs namenjen?

Kurs je namenjen svima onima koji žele da nadograde svoje znanje iz oblasti testiranje kvaliteta softvera. Za ovaj kurs je potrebno biti upoznat sa onsvnim principima QA, posedovati osnovnu računarsku pismenost i osnovno poznavanje engleskoh jezika.

Kako mogu da se prijavim?

Da biste se prijavili na kurs kliknite na dugme KUPI KURS, zatim pratite korake za registraciju. Nakon uspešne uplate prve rate, moćićete da učestvujete na kursu.

Gde i kako mogu da pratim predavanja?

Celokupna nastava se održava ONLINE. Nekoliko dana pred sam početak kursa ćete dobiti mail sa detaljnim uputsvima za pristupanje kursu.

Koliko kurs košta i šta je sve uključeno u cenu?

Cena kursa iznosi 37 000, 00 rsd.
U cenu su uključeni:

Kako izgleda ispit i kada se održava?

Ispit će se održati online i biće teorijski. Biće u formi testa i održaće se 2024.

Da li ću dobiti sertifikat ako položim ispit?

Ako položite ispit sa minimum 70% tačnosti, dobijate SoftUni sertifikat o položenom kursu.

Predavač

USKORO
U ponudi imamo kurs Osnove QA i QA Automatizacija, kao i paket kurseva za kompletnu QA obuku.
Ukoliko želite da pročitate više o paketu kurseva za kompletnu QA obuku, kliknite OVDE.
U koliko želite da pročitate više o kursu Osnove QA klinite OVDE.
Za sve dodatne informacije možete nas kontaktirati na email: studentskasluzba@softuni.rs
ili na broj telefona: +381 60 282 31 18
Share